Pakal Dul power project snatches land, leaves youth jobless
Early Times Report
JAMMU, Feb 3: Scores of residents of the Kishtwar district today held a protest support of their demands and said that the management of 1000 megawatts Pakal Dul power project should provide jobs to the children of land owners and provide compensation in lieu of land.
The protesters said that at the time of commissioning of the power project they were told that the children of land owners would be given job while as adequate compensation would be provided to the people who opt for cash relief. They said that no demand was met and there has been no headway in this regard.
The protesters said that the management should wake up to the situation and take the corrective measures at the earliest. They warned of dire consequences in case the demands are not met by the management of the power project.
